Will China build a fusion-fission hybrid nuclear power plant?
The Experimental Advanced Superconducting Tokamak reactor in China is part of global efforts to develop nuclear fusion. Courtesy Iter. China is poised to start building the world’s first fusion-fission hybrid nuclear power plant, with the goal of generating 100 MW of continuous electricity and connecting to the grid by the end of the decade.
What is the role of China in fusion energy?
As a key player in the global pursuit of fusion energy, China joined the International Thermonuclear Experimental Reactor (ITER) project in 2006 as its seventh member. Under the agreement, China contributes about 9 percent of ITER’s construction and operation, with ASIPP overseeing China’s participation.

Can superconducting tokamaks be used in fusion reactors?
Research into controlled fusion energy has been ongoing for over half a century. China has created a clear roadmap for magnetic confinement fusion development, where superconducting tokamaks will be used in commercial fusion reactors.
